Transaction de8840251667156e864143f97ea43d855ab3acae117e947d6b02feb2a00bac16
1 Input
1 Output
-
de8840251667156e864143f97ea43d855ab3acae117e947d6b02feb2a00bac16:0
- value
- 395598
- script pubkey
- OP_0 OP_PUSHBYTES_20 3d0c2cc473c0f0ea4569f55e880c3f5c0d4db40a
- address
- bc1q85xze3rncrcw53tf740gsrpltsx5mdq2fezqvg